The chart shows student expenditure over a three-year period in the United Kingdom.

Summarise the information by selecting and reporting the main features, and make comparisons where relevant.

Write at least 150 words.

The bar chart highlights how students spent their money in 1996 and 1999.

Overall, what stands out from the graph is that entertainment represented the greatest part of expenditure in 1996 as well as in 1999. Additionally, children were the least important figure in 1996 and not part of an expenditure for students in 1999.

Looking at student expenditure in 1996, we observe a difference of 3 percentage points between entertainment and accommodation expenditure. Furthermore, food and household spendings were twice as many as course ones. Regarding other spendings such as non-essential consumer items and credit repayments constituted more than 15% of total expenditure.

Focusing on student expenditure in 1999, we witness that entertainment ones was significant as it reached 30% of total expenditure. Moreover, food and accommodation expenditure were almost similar with 18% and 20%, respectively. Regarding travels, it is clear that essential travel represented a greatest part of the expenditure than non-essential travel in 1999. Finally, course expenditure has known a fall between 1996 and 1999.
